A. Thomas to 49ers?
Hey all --
We're hearing that linebacker Adalius Thomas, coveted by many a Pats fans, will be signing with the San Francisco 49ers a little after midnight, when his free agency becomes official.
Word is, Thomas will get a signing bonus somewhere in the $12-15 million range, which reflects the increased cap. Last year, the Seahawks signed backer Julian Peterson to a seven-year, $54-million deal that included an $11.5 million signing bonus. The contract also got him $5.5 million in roster bonuses over the first three years of the deal.
